The Credit Union SFL: Division 1 Round 3. Austin Stacks V Ballymacelligott

The Credit Union SFL: Division 1 Round 3.

Easter Saturday 8th April @6pm in Connolly Park. (scroll down for video clip highlights)

Austin Stacks: 1-13
Ballymacelligott 3-13

The heartwarming lesson from this match came eight minutes into the first half when Ballymac rallied and scored a point when Stacks had gone two points up. The Ballymac lads having had two defeats in the County League could have lost confidence, however their resilience showed and they scored three more scores and never lost this lead until the final whistle.

It was a beautiful breezy evening in Connolly Park and there was a great support for both teams on this Easter Saturday evening. Aidan Breen opened the scoring with a point. A point from Michael O’Callaghan and two from Shane O’Callaghan gave Stacks a two point lead. Ballymac united in their purpose scored three points one a free from Aidan Breen, one from Daire Keane and a free converted  from Aidan Breen on a foul on Niall Collins. The score after fifteen minutes was 0-3 to 0-6 to Ballymac.

Stacks scored a point , a  point each from Aidan Breen  and Niall Collins  followed by a goal from  Daire Keane increased the lead for our lads. Three more points from Stacks and one from Ballymac left the half time score 0-7 to 1-9.

After the break Niall Collins continued to rattle the Stacks back line with his perceptive runs and was working well with his fellow forwards. Points from Donal Daly and Vinny Horan and two from Stacks left the goal between them. Niall Collins game was over  after a particularly nasty foul. A point from Michael Herlihy followed by two goals from Aidan Breen & Vinnie Horan ended the game as a contest. Donal Daly scored Ballymac’s last point. In the last five minutes the home team scored three points and got a goal from a penalty well into added time.

This was a good result for Ballymac with a man of the match performance from Dylan Dunne Moriarty well supported by his fellow backs. Christy Leen did well in goals and his handling and distribution added to the flow of the game.  Once again great performances from by the forwards who worked well as a unit ensured Ballymac got that well deserved two points.
